Нейросеть

Алгоритмы и их Исполнители: Фундаментальные Основы и Применение в Информатике (Реферат)

Нейросеть для реферата Гарантия уникальности Строго по ГОСТу Высочайшее качество Поддержка 24/7

Данный реферат посвящен изучению алгоритмов и их исполнителей, ключевых концепций в области информатики. Рассматриваются основные типы алгоритмов, методы их разработки и анализа. Особое внимание уделяется роли исполнителей в выполнении алгоритмов и влиянию их характеристик на производительность. Работа включает теоретический обзор, рассмотрение практических примеров и анализ перспектив дальнейшего развития.

Результаты:

В результате работы будет сформировано понимание фундаментальных принципов алгоритмизации и роли исполнителей, что позволит применять полученные знания на практике.

Актуальность:

Изучение алгоритмов и исполнителей актуально в современном мире, поскольку они лежат в основе функционирования всех информационных систем, от простых приложений до сложных научных вычислений.

Цель:

Целью реферата является систематизация знаний об алгоритмах и исполнителях, а также анализ их взаимосвязи и практического применения.

Наименование образовательного учреждения

Реферат

на тему

Алгоритмы и их Исполнители: Фундаментальные Основы и Применение в Информатике

Выполнил: ФИО

Руководитель: ФИО

Содержание

  • Введение 1
  • Основные Понятия и Определения Алгоритмов 2
    • - Определение и Свойства Алгоритмов 2.1
    • - Типы Алгоритмов и их Классификация 2.2
    • - Методы Разработки Алгоритмов 2.3
  • Исполнители Алгоритмов: Типы и Характеристики 3
    • - Виды Исполнителей и их Возможности 3.1
    • - Характеристики Исполнителей: Скорость, Память, Точность 3.2
    • - Взаимодействие Алгоритма и Исполнителя 3.3
  • Анализ Алгоритмов: Сложность и Эффективность 4
    • - Оценка Сложности Алгоритмов: Временная и Пространственная 4.1
    • - Влияние Выбора Алгоритма на Производительность 4.2
    • - Оптимальные Алгоритмы и Методы их Выбора 4.3
  • Практическое Применение Алгоритмов и Исполнителей 5
    • - Примеры Алгоритмов и их Реализация 5.1
    • - Практическое применение в различных областях 5.2
    • - Оптимизация Алгоритмов для конкретных исполнителей 5.3
  • Заключение 6
  • Список литературы 7

Введение

Содержимое раздела

Введение в тему алгоритмов и их исполнителей закладывает основу для понимания ключевых концепций информатики. Раскрываются основные понятия: алгоритм и исполнитель, их взаимосвязь и значимость в современных информационных технологиях. Описывается структура реферата, его цели и задачи, а также краткий обзор рассматриваемых тем и их актуальности для дальнейшего обучения.

Основные Понятия и Определения Алгоритмов

Содержимое раздела

Этот раздел представляет собой детальное исследование основных понятий, связанных с алгоритмами. Рассматриваются различные типы алгоритмов: линейные, разветвляющиеся и циклические, а также их характеристики и области применения. Подробно анализируются свойства алгоритмов, такие как конечность, определенность, результативность и массовость. Объясняется роль алгоритмов в решении разнообразных задач.

    Определение и Свойства Алгоритмов

    Содержимое раздела

    Детальное определение алгоритма и его ключевых свойств: конечности, определенности, результативности и массовости. Раскрывается значение каждого свойства для корректной работы алгоритма. Примеры, иллюстрирующие ситуации, когда нарушение этих свойств приводит к некорректным результатам или полному сбою.

    Типы Алгоритмов и их Классификация

    Содержимое раздела

    Обзор различных типов алгоритмов. Рассматриваются линейные, разветвляющиеся и циклические алгоритмы. Обсуждаются основные принципы классификации алгоритмов по различным критериям, таким как структура, сложность и используемые методы. Приводятся примеры алгоритмов для каждой категории.

    Методы Разработки Алгоритмов

    Содержимое раздела

    Обзор основных методов разработки алгоритмов: нисходящее проектирование, восходящее проектирование, метод "разделяй и властвуй". Описываются преимущества и недостатки каждого метода. Обсуждаются инструменты и подходы, используемые для оптимизации процесса разработки алгоритмов.

Исполнители Алгоритмов: Типы и Характеристики

Содержимое раздела

В этом разделе рассматриваются различные типы исполнителей алгоритмов и их ключевые характеристики. Анализируются как абстрактные, так и конкретные исполнители, их возможности и ограничения. Особое внимание уделяется влиянию характеристик исполнителя на производительность и выбор алгоритма. Обсуждается взаимодействие между алгоритмом и исполнителем.

    Виды Исполнителей и их Возможности

    Содержимое раздела

    Рассмотрение различных типов исполнителей: человек, компьютер, робот. Анализ возможностей каждого типа исполнителя, включая его аппаратные и программные ресурсы. Примеры задач, которые могут быть решены каждым типом исполнителя, и их ограничения.

    Характеристики Исполнителей: Скорость, Память, Точность

    Содержимое раздела

    Детальный разбор основных характеристик исполнителей, таких как скорость выполнения команд, объем доступной памяти и точность вычислений. Обсуждение влияния этих характеристик на выбор алгоритма и его производительность. Примеры, иллюстрирующие зависимость производительности от характеристик исполнителей.

    Взаимодействие Алгоритма и Исполнителя

    Содержимое раздела

    Анализ взаимодействия алгоритма и исполнителя. Обсуждение роли команд и инструкций в алгоритме, которые понимает исполнитель. Рассматриваются способы адаптации алгоритмов под конкретного исполнителя для повышения эффективности. Примеры оптимизации алгоритмов для конкретных исполнителей.

Анализ Алгоритмов: Сложность и Эффективность

Содержимое раздела

Этот раздел посвящен анализу алгоритмов, включая их сложность и эффективность. Рассматриваются различные методы оценки сложности алгоритмов, а также влияние выбора алгоритма на производительность. Анализируются временная и пространственная сложность. Изучаются оптимальные алгоритмы для решения различных задач и методы их выбора.

    Оценка Сложности Алгоритмов: Временная и Пространственная

    Содержимое раздела

    Обзор методов оценки сложности алгоритмов, включая временную и пространственную сложность. Объяснение понятий асимптотической нотации (O-большое). Примеры анализа сложности различных алгоритмов.

    Влияние Выбора Алгоритма на Производительность

    Содержимое раздела

    Анализ влияния выбора алгоритма на производительность системы. Обсуждение преимуществ и недостатков различных алгоритмов для решения конкретных задач. Примеры, демонстрирующие зависимость производительности от выбора алгоритма.

    Оптимальные Алгоритмы и Методы их Выбора

    Содержимое раздела

    Рассмотрение критериев выбора оптимальных алгоритмов для конкретных задач. Обзор методов выбора оптимальных алгоритмов, включая сравнение их сложности и производительности. Примеры, иллюстрирующие выбор оптимальных алгоритмов для решения конкретных проблем.

Практическое Применение Алгоритмов и Исполнителей

Содержимое раздела

Этот раздел включает в себя практические примеры применения алгоритмов и исполнителей в различных областях. Рассматриваются конкретные задачи и их решения, а также типы исполнителей, используемые для их решения. Анализируются реальные кейсы использования алгоритмов. Показаны возможности оптимизации алгоритмов для конкретных исполнителей.

    Примеры Алгоритмов и их Реализация

    Содержимое раздела

    Рассмотрение конкретных примеров алгоритмов сортировки, поиска и других. Обзор различных способов реализации этих алгоритмов на разных языках программирования. Анализ эффективности и характеристик каждого из примеров.

    Практическое применение в различных областях

    Содержимое раздела

    Анализ применения алгоритмов в различных областях, включая программирование, робототехнику, машинное обучение и другие. Рассмотрение конкретных задач и их решений в каждой области.

    Оптимизация Алгоритмов для конкретных исполнителей

    Содержимое раздела

    Как адаптировать алгоритмы для конкретных исполнителей (например, для конкретной архитектуры процессора). Обсуждение различных методов оптимизации алгоритмов. Анализ эффективности.

Заключение

Содержимое раздела

В заключении обобщаются основные результаты исследования алгоритмов и их исполнителей. Подводятся итоги работы, делаются выводы о важности и применимости изученных концепций. Оценивается вклад работы в понимание предметной области, а также обсуждаются перспективы дальнейшего развития и направления будущих исследований.

Список литературы

Содержимое раздела

Список использованных источников: книг, статей, научных публикаций, ресурсов интернета. Рекомендации по оформлению списка литературы в соответствии со стандартами.

Получи Такой Реферат

До 90% уникальность
Готовый файл Word
Оформление по ГОСТ
Список источников по ГОСТ
Таблицы и схемы
Презентация

Создать Реферат на любую тему за 5 минут

Создать

#5685204